Yuliia Starodubtseva vs Ajla Tomljanovic H2H: 0-2
Ajla Tomljanovic holds a 2–0 lead over Yuliia Starodubtseva in their WTA head-to-head. Across 2 main-draw meetings, Ajla Tomljanovic leads 2–0 on hard courts. Most recently, Ajla Tomljanovic won the 2026 Australian Open first round 4-6 7-6(3) 6-1.

H2H Match Log
| Date | Tournament | Category | Round | Surface | Winner | Score | Loser | Match |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an 19, 2026 | Australian Open | Grand Slam | R128 | Hard | Ajla Tomljanovic | 4-6 7-6(3) 6-1 | Yuliia Starodubtseva | Match data |
| Sep 25, 2025 | Beijing | WTA 1000 | R128 | Hard | Ajla Tomljanovic | 7-6(1) 6-2 | Yuliia Starodubtseva | Match data |
